Foundation Stabilizing in Metuchen, NJ
Foundation stabilizing services involve techniques to strengthen and support the structural integrity of a building’s foundation. These services are often requested for projects such as settling or shifting foundations, cracks in basement walls, uneven floors, or doors and windows that no longer open properly. Property owners typically seek this type of stabilization to prevent further damage, improve safety, and maintain the value of their home. Understanding the specific cause of foundation movement and the extent of any existing damage is essential before pursuing stabilization work.
Before requesting foundation stabilizing services, homeowners usually want to know what methods are available, how the process might affect their property, and what kind of results to expect. It’s important to consider the type of foundation, soil conditions, and the severity of any issues. Property owners should also inquire about the scope of work, potential disruptions during the process, and the long-term benefits of stabilization to ensure the project aligns with their needs and expectations.

Common Foundation Stabilizing Jobs
Foundation Stabilizing - techniques to strengthen and support settling or shifting foundations.
Pier and Beam Support - elevating and stabilizing homes built on piers or beams.
Concrete Underpinning - reinforcing concrete slabs that have cracked or become uneven.
Soil Stabilization - improving soil conditions to prevent future foundation movement.
Foundation Jacking - lifting and leveling a foundation that has settled over time.
Wall Reinforcement - stabilizing basement or crawl space walls to prevent collapse.
Foundation Stabilizing Questions
What are foundation stabilizing services? They involve techniques to reinforce and support the foundation of a property, helping to prevent further settling or damage.
When is foundation stabilization needed? It is typically required when signs of shifting, cracking, or uneven floors appear in a property.
What methods are used for foundation stabilization? Common methods include underpinning, piering, and installing support beams to strengthen the foundation.
What signs indicate a property may need foundation stabilization? Visible cracks in walls or floors, doors or windows that stick, and uneven flooring are common indicators.
